A letter circulating from online, purporting to be that of Muhammad Babangida’s rejection of his appointment as chairman of the Bank of Agriculture, has been deemed to be fake
Muhammed is the son of former military president Ibrahim Babangida. His appointment was announced by President Bola Tinubu last week
The letter rejecting the appointment claimed “personal and professional considerations” for his decision.

But Kassim Afegbua, who enjoys a close relationships with the Babangida’s and is the spokesman’s to his
father. President Ibrahim Babangida, described the letter circulating as fake news.
Afegbua, who confirmed this development to AIT, said the letter, which allegedly declined President Bola Tinubu’s appointment of Mohammed Babangida as Chairman of Bank of Agriculture is the handiwork of mischief makers
